Nick Connor

Associate Director

Nick combines commercial thinking with legal experience to help clients navigate complex PR challenges. Originally trained as a lawyer in London, Nick works on a number of high profile PR mandates for litigation, reputation and crisis clients, working from both the New York and London offices.

Nick works closely with the legal teams of plaintiffs and defendants before, during, and after trials, using his understanding of commercial litigation to effectively convey clients’ messaging in situations of intense scrutiny. His PR experience includes major fraud cases, employment proceedings, class actions, environmental claims, financial disputes and criminal investigations, and he has worked with prominent individuals, listed corporations, and leading businesses in manufacturing, consulting, food, technology and private equity.

He has also worked for both corporates and HNWIs on complex and fast-moving reputational challenges separate to litigation. This includes guiding clients through challenging periods of public and shareholder scrutiny, including managing responses to social media campaigns and damaging media coverage.

While now a non-practicing lawyer, during his legal career at Hogan Lovells, Nick worked on significant international disputes, transactions and investigations for corporate clients. He spent six months seconded to the headquarters of Vodafone, where he advised on environmental and reputational issues for their global business.

Clients have praised Nick as “brilliant”, with a “nice blend of experience”. He holds a first class degree in History from Durham University and a Master’s degree in American History from University of Oxford.
